In the world of construction, choosing the right materials is like selecting the best ingredients for a recipe. When it comes to Materials for External Wall Thermal Insulation, the choices can significantly impact energy efficiency. Homeowners and builders often express their concerns about which materials to use. Some prefer traditional options like fiberglass, while others explore newer materials like spray foam. Each option has its pros and cons. Fiberglass is known for affordability but can be less effective in extreme temperatures. Spray foam, on the other hand, offers superior insulation but comes at a higher cost. It's essential to balance these factors. Users often seek guidance from industry experts to make informed decisions. Energy efficiency standards also play a crucial role in this selection process. Regulations may dictate minimum R-values, which measure thermal resistance. This means that selecting a material that meets or exceeds these standards is vital for compliance and long-term savings. Cost management cannot be overlooked either. While initial expenses matter, considering long-term savings on energy bills is equally important. Materials for External Wall Thermal Insulation and Thermal Insulation Materials

Understanding Thermal Insulation Materials is fundamental for anyone interested in energy-efficient buildings. These materials act as barriers against heat transfer, keeping homes warm in winter and cool in summer. There are various types of insulation available, including rigid foam boards, mineral wool, and cellulose. Rigid foam boards are popular due to their high insulating value per inch. They are often used in modern constructions. Mineral wool, made from natural or recycled materials, provides excellent fire resistance and soundproofing properties. Cellulose, derived from recycled paper, is an eco-friendly choice that appeals to environmentally conscious homeowners. Each material has unique characteristics that can meet different needs. Choosing the right External Wall Insulation Techniques is equally important. Techniques vary from traditional batten and board systems to modern methods like external insulated finishing systems (EIFS). These systems not only enhance insulation but also improve the aesthetic appeal of buildings. The relationship between Energy Efficiency, External Wall Insulation Techniques, and building regulations is tightly woven. Regulations often dictate how much insulation is needed based on climate zones. For instance, homes in colder regions require more insulation than those in warmer climates.
